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Swindon (Wilts) to Manchester Piccadilly start from as little as £34.60

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Swindon (Wilts) to Manchester Piccadilly start from £111.70 one way, or £112.90 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Swindon (Wilts) to Manchester Piccadilly are available for £118.50 one way, or £236.90 return

Facilities and Amenities at Swindon (Wilts) Station

The station is well-equipped to handle the needs of modern travelers. With a ticket office open throughout the week and ticket machines available at multiple locations including accessible ones at the station's entrance, purchasing tickets is both easy and efficient. Your smartcards can also be obtained and validated here, making your journey smoother. For those in need of assistance, help points are readily available, and customer service staff are on hand to provide support. Though there isn't luggage storage, there is comprehensive CCTV coverage to ensure security.

Swindon Station is a Category A station, offering step-free access across all platforms via a subway and lifts. Accessibility is prioritized with features such as ramps for train access, wheelchair availability, and accessible car park equipment. Car parking is ample with 591 spaces available 24/7, including eight designated accessible spaces. Despite the station's excellent facilities, there are no accessible toilets or a first-class lounge, but there's a baby changing area at Platform 4.

Station Facilities and Amenities

Manchester Piccadilly expertly caters to passenger needs with a variety of facilities. The ticket office operates diligently from as early as 4:30 am to 10:30 pm through the week, ensuring you can grab a ticket for those early morning travels. For those tech-savvy commuters, ticket machines are readily available and accessible, allowing smooth online ticket collection. The station is well-equipped for accessibility; offering step-free access, ramps, and tactile warning strips for the visually impaired make it a user-friendly place for all travelers.

The station boasts free public Wi-Fi, ATM machines, and a plethora of shops and dining options. Coffee lovers will appreciate the numerous kiosks, while those in need of essentials can visit the mini supermarkets and pharmacies located within the station. The station even went the extra mile to ensure comfort by providing lounges, including a 1st Class Lounge and an Assisted Travel Lounge, making it an amenable waiting experience.

Transport Links and Connectivity

Getting to and from Manchester Piccadilly is a breeze with its robust transport links. Metrolink trams connect you to key destinations like Bury, Rochdale, and Manchester Airport, among others. For those preferring buses, a network of frequent local services are operated by 'First' and 'Stagecoach'. There's also a free bus service that runs every ten minutes around the city center—a convenient option for quick city hops.

The taxi rank located at the Fairfield Street exit offers service between 2 am to 5 am, giving you round-the-clock availability. If you're looking to explore the city on two wheels, Brompton bicycles are available for hire with two flexible tariffs. Additionally, if you're embarking on a flight, Manchester International Airport is just 9-10 miles away with several direct train services throughout the day. Car hire agents are also a short walk from the station, providing flexibility in travel.
